Final answer:

The correct answer is C. 'World Leader' should be 'world leader'.


Step-by-step explanation:

The correct answer is C. 'World Leader'. In the sentence, 'World Leader' should not be capitalized because it is not a proper noun. Proper nouns are capitalized, while common nouns are not. 'World Leader' is a common noun phrase that does not refer to a specific person or title. Therefore, it should be lowercase.
